Strategies for Cost Reduction
Implementing effective cost reduction strategies is essential for businesses aiming to enhance their financial health and operational efficiency.
Employing cost cutting measures, such as renegotiating supplier contracts and optimizing resource allocation, can lead to significant savings.
Additionally, consistent expense tracking enables organizations to identify unnecessary expenditures, facilitating informed decisions that promote sustainable financial practices and ultimately foster a culture of fiscal responsibility.
